LAKE WALES, Fla. – (RV) Royals take the win from the Nighthawks in game one of the series.
The history between these two teams dates back to 2006. The last time Warner faced Thomas was in The Sun Conference tournament back in 2019. Due to the season-ending early because of COVID-19 in the season of 2020, these two teams did not have the chance to play each other last season. The overall record is 17-18 in favor of the Nighthawks.

The starting pitcher for the Royals was
Freddy Gonzalez, he pitched 4 innings. Senior, Andy Yarbrough went in relief of Gonzalez. Yarbrough went 5 innings taking the win off of the mound improving his overall record to 4-0.
